In the dynamic landscape of real-time strategy (RTS) esports, a new titan emerges, heralding a renaissance with the close of the EGC Stormgate Open. This marquee event spotlighted the potential of Stormgate, a game quickly ascending in popularity within the genre. Hosted by the dedicated channel EGCTV, the tournament seized the attention of the RTS community, featuring an impressive $10,000 USD prize pool that drew international talent to its digital battlegrounds.

The event coincided with the adrenaline-pumping 2024 Steam Next Fest, a period marked by peak excitement for gaming enthusiasts worldwide. Competitors aspiring to ascend the ranks and reach the playoffs had to navigate through the perilous waters of open qualifiers. Initially structured as a double-elimination gauntlet, it transitioned to a ruthless single-elimination format, raising the stakes and the pressure on the aspirants. In this crucible, only the eight most resilient players survived to reach the playoff stage.

The Path to Victory

The journey to the finals did not end there, as the Katowice Qualifiers threw open its doors, offering an additional four slots to the tenacious contenders who could outplay and outwit their opponents. The ensuing semifinals tested the mettle of the competitors with a grueling best-of-seven format, ensuring that only the most consistent and strategic minds could vie for the championship title.

Then came the finals—a battle of wits and nerves in a best-of-nine series that promised not only a hefty cash reward but also the acclaim of emerging victorious in a field of the world's best.

Adding a layer of depth to the event, renowned commentators, Artosis and Tasteless, took to the stage to offer their seasoned insights, elevating the viewer experience with their vast knowledge and enthusiasm for the game. It's no surprise that well-known players like Kiwian, PartinG, LucifroN, and VortiX were among the stars who entered the arena, bringing with them legacies of skill and strategy honed in some of the finest competitive circuits in esports.
